西藏青稞产区土壤和籽粒硒含量相关性分析

Correlation Analysis of Selenium Content in Soil and Highland Barley Grains in Xizang

Abstract

In order to clarify the selenium content of highland barley grain and cultivation soil in Xizang highland barley production area and the correlation between them,the soil and highland barley grain in 16 locations in Xizang highland barley production area were sampled and investigated.The results showed that the selenium content of soil in Xizang highland barley production area ranged from 0.039 2 to 0.672 3 mg/kg,of which 27.78%was selenium deficient soil,22.22%was moderate selenium soil,and 50%was selenium rich soil.The selenium content of barley grains ranged from 0.009 8 to 0.331 2 mg/kg,with 50%of the samples having insufficient selenium content.At the same time,there is a significant positive correlation between the selenium content of soil in Xizang highland barley production areas and the selenium content of highland barley grains.The experimental results of exploring the factors affecting the selenium content of soil and barley grains showed that there was no significant difference in the selenium content of barley grains among Zangqing 2000,Zangqing 320 and 5171 in the experiment.In addition,compared with conventional tillage,the powder ridge tillage technique did not have a significant effect on the selenium content of soil and Zangqing 3000 grains.However,under the same soil condition,the selenium content in the grains of the barley variety Dongqing 18 was significantly lower than that of the spring barley variety Zangqing 2000.
